Neutrophils have been implicated in atherosclerosis but their detailed role in PAD pathogenesis is not well documented. Buso et al. present in their manuscript a study exploring the prognostic value of circulating markers of neutrophil activation for MACE and MALE in patients with symptomatic PAD. They report that PMN elastase and MPO are predictive of 6-month MACE and/or MALE. Overall, the work is well done.

Concerns and suggestions

-In the manuscript there is no description of neutrophil activity assessment but rather the measurement of markers of neutrophil activation. In view of this, I feel the wording of “Enhanced neutrophil activity” in the title should be modified. 

-The authors discussed the work by Shahab et al. (Vascular. 2021;29:363-371) short of stressing the prognostic value of serum MPO levels for MACE and MALE in patients with PAD shown by the original authors.

-Is “2%” (line 93 on page 2) the estimated death probability by the GRACE Score?

-To determine the performance of MPO and PMN elastase in predicting the events (e.g., sensitivity and specificity), I suggest the authors conduct the receiver operating characteristic (ROC) curve analysis and obtain an area under the curve (AUC) value for each marker.

  • The authors discussed the work by Shahab et al. (Vascular. 2021;29:363-371) short of stressing the prognostic value of serum MPO levels for MACE and MALE in patients with PAD shown by the original authors.

We thank the Reviewer for the suggestion. In order to further emphasize the results of Schahab et al. we have modified the corresponding text in the Discussion section as follows: “Intriguingly enough, in a recent prospective cohort study including patients with PAD undergoing digital subtraction angiography, baseline MPO levels were 3.68 times higher in patients with all-cause death and MACE, and 1.48 times higher in those with MALE than those without such outcomes at 24 months follow-up. Moreover, the authors found higher MPO levels in patients with multi-bed vascular disease compared with those with PAD alone, suggesting that this biomarker may reflect the extent of vascular damage in patients with atherosclerotic disease” (page 10, lines 372-379).
